Do St. Gabriel students take Physical Education?
Yes, full time students attending St. Gabriel Cyber School are required to take Physical Education in grade 7 through 10. Physical Education is offered to grade 11 and 12 students as well. Students receive lessons about nutrition, fitness, health, and particular sports. They complete a fitness test several times a year to monitor their progress and promote fitness awareness. Students also compile a logbook of their physical activity. A designated portion of the activity hours must be pursued with an organized group; for example, an evening of basketball with a church youth group, a Scouts’ sports night, or playing on a hockey team. Each activity entry in the logbook must be verified with the signature of a parent, coach, or supervising adult.
